news 2026/6/9 22:39:31

智能PPT提取工具:5分钟学会视频课件自动化整理

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
智能PPT提取工具:5分钟学会视频课件自动化整理

智能PPT提取工具:5分钟学会视频课件自动化整理

【免费下载链接】extract-video-pptextract the ppt in the video项目地址: https://gitcode.com/gh_mirrors/ex/extract-video-ppt

还在为繁琐的视频PPT截图而烦恼吗?智能PPT提取工具正是你需要的终极解决方案。这个免费开源项目能够自动识别视频中的PPT画面,智能去重并生成高质量文档,让课件管理效率提升8倍以上。

💡 传统痛点与智能优势

手动操作的三大挑战

  • 时间消耗巨大:1小时视频需要40分钟手动操作
  • 质量难以保证:截图模糊、角度不正、容易遗漏
  • 重复劳动负担:机械性操作占用宝贵时间

智能提取的四大突破

  • 一键式操作:无需专业技能,简单命令完成复杂任务
  • 智能去重技术:自动过滤相似画面,避免重复页面
  • 广泛格式兼容:支持MP4、AVI、MOV等主流视频
  • 高清输出质量:保持原始画质,支持PDF等多种格式

🚀 快速上手:零基础5分钟掌握

环境准备与安装

确保系统已安装Python 3.8+环境,通过以下命令获取工具:

git clone https://gitcode.com/gh_mirrors/ex/extract-video-ppt cd extract-video-ppt pip install extract-video-ppt

核心操作流程

使用evp命令进行智能PPT提取:

evp --similarity 0.6 --pdfname 我的课件.pdf ./输出文件夹 ./我的视频.mp4

关键参数详解

  • --similarity:画面相似度阈值,控制去重强度
  • --pdfname:指定输出PDF文档名称
  • 输出文件夹和视频文件路径为必需参数

智能PPT提取工具自动识别视频中的关键帧画面

进阶功能应用

时间范围精准控制

evp --start_frame 0:00:09 --end_frame 00:00:30 --pdfname 部分课件.pdf ./输出文件夹 ./视频文件.mp4

批量处理多个视频

for file in *.mp4; do evp --pdfname "${file%.*}.pdf" ./输出文件夹 "./$file" done

📊 性能对比:智能vs手动

对比维度手动操作智能提取
处理时间40分钟8分钟
操作难度
输出质量不稳定高清
重复页面常见自动过滤

实际应用数据统计

  • 学术讲座:45张PPT,耗时9分钟完成
  • 在线课程:70张幻灯片,耗时14分钟
  • 会议记录:25张页面,仅需7分钟

🔧 技术核心深度解析

智能处理引擎

工具基于OpenCV构建视频处理核心,位于video2ppt/video2ppt.py,主要功能包括:

  • 智能帧采样:每秒提取关键帧,避免冗余
  • 相似度计算:通过compare.py模块精确比对
  • PDF生成:使用images2pdf.py模块转换文档

去重算法优化指南

相似度参数设置策略

  • 严格模式:0.85-0.95,适合内容变化较小的视频
  • 平衡模式:0.75-0.85,大多数场景推荐使用
  • 宽松模式:0.65-0.75,适合快速浏览和初步筛选

💫 专业使用技巧大全

视频源选择最佳实践

质量保障建议

  • 分辨率不低于720P,确保文字清晰可读
  • PPT画面占据屏幕主要区域,减少背景干扰
  • 每页PPT停留时间超过3秒,提高识别准确率

常见问题解决方案

提取效果不理想

  • 页面不完整:检查PPT显示时长,调整相似度阈值
  • 质量不佳:使用更高分辨率视频源,避免过度压缩
  • 去重不准确:根据视频特点选择合适的相似度参数

🌟 全方位应用场景

学生用户必备

  • 在线课程课件整理:快速获取教学PPT,便于复习
  • 学术讲座资料收集:自动提取演讲者展示的重要幻灯片
  • 学习资料数字化:将视频内容转换为可编辑文档格式

职场人士利器

  • 会议记录整理:从会议录像中提取重要演示内容
  • 培训资料归档:整理企业内部培训的课件资料
  • 项目汇报素材:收集优秀汇报案例中的PPT设计

教育工作者助手

  • 教学视频优化:从录制的课程中提取PPT用于后续教学
  • 课件制作参考:收集优质PPT设计作为教学素材

📈 效率提升量化分析

时间节省计算

  • 传统方式:每张PPT耗时50秒操作
  • 智能提取:每张PPT仅需9秒处理
  • 效率提升倍数:5.5倍

质量改善指标

  • 清晰度提升:28%
  • 完整性提高:22%
  • 错误率降低:75%

🔮 未来发展路线图

作为持续发展的开源项目,未来将重点优化:

  • 支持更多视频编码格式和特殊格式
  • 增强复杂背景下的PPT识别准确率
  • 提供图形化操作界面,进一步降低使用门槛
  • 集成云端处理能力,支持更大规模视频处理

立即开始使用智能PPT提取工具,体验高效课件整理流程,让视频内容价值最大化!

【免费下载链接】extract-video-pptextract the ppt in the video项目地址: https://gitcode.com/gh_mirrors/ex/extract-video-ppt

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 14:24:46

LVGL与STM32触摸屏校准集成的通俗解释

手把手教你搞定LVGLSTM32触摸屏校准:从原理到实战的完整闭环你有没有遇到过这样的情况?在自己的STM32开发板上跑起了LVGL界面,按钮做得漂漂亮亮,动画也流畅,结果一碰屏幕——点哪儿不对哪儿。明明点了“确定”按钮&…

作者头像 李华
网站建设 2026/6/10 11:52:21

13、持续改进 API:提升可变更性与速度的策略

持续改进 API:提升可变更性与速度的策略 1. API 变更概述 在 API 开发过程中,对其任何部分进行更改都会使变更成本增加,尤其是随着为开发者体验开发更多支持资产时。同时,也可以对支持资产进行独立更改,例如更新文档页面的外观和感觉。这类更改虽对接口模型、实现或实例无…

作者头像 李华
网站建设 2026/6/10 14:19:50

基于帧间相似度分析的视频PPT智能提取技术

基于帧间相似度分析的视频PPT智能提取技术 【免费下载链接】extract-video-ppt extract the ppt in the video 项目地址: https://gitcode.com/gh_mirrors/ex/extract-video-ppt 在数字化教育和工作场景中,从视频内容中提取PPT幻灯片已成为重要的技术需求。传…

作者头像 李华
网站建设 2026/6/9 19:56:25

12、高级内存取证中的STL容器剖析

高级内存取证中的STL容器剖析 在软件开发尤其是游戏开发中,有效地管理数据是至关重要的。C++标准模板库(STL)提供了一系列强大的容器类,如 std::vector 、 std::list 和 std::map ,它们在游戏内存管理中发挥着重要作用。本文将深入探讨这些容器的结构、使用方法以及…

作者头像 李华
网站建设 2026/6/10 15:10:22

16、API 产品生命周期各阶段关键支柱解析

API 产品生命周期各阶段关键支柱解析 1. 退休阶段里程碑与影响因素 退休阶段的里程碑代表着一个下限或上限阈值。例如,可以为维护阶段的 API 设置必须服务的最小请求数,或者在产品进入退休阶段之前设置最大成本水平。产品退休的成本因它所支持的应用程序类型和开发者用户规…

作者头像 李华
网站建设 2026/6/10 11:38:30

Xenos终极指南:掌握Windows DLL注入的专业技巧

Xenos终极指南:掌握Windows DLL注入的专业技巧 【免费下载链接】Xenos Windows dll injector 项目地址: https://gitcode.com/gh_mirrors/xe/Xenos Xenos作为一款功能强大的Windows DLL注入器,为开发者和安全研究人员提供了完整的动态加载解决方案…

作者头像 李华